Kenya denies banning avocado exports.
2025-07-08 00:00
The authorities have addressed concerns about misinformation circulating among stakeholders in the horticulture industry regarding Kenyan avocado exports. They clarified that there has been no discussion or proposal to ban the export of fresh avocados. A recent meeting was held on June 25, 2025, focusing on avocado oil.

Peruvian citrus exports grew by 50% between January and May.
2025-07-08 00:00
The Ministry of Agriculture and Irrigation in Peru has reported that the country exported over 100,000 tons of citrus fruits between January and May of this year, which is a 50% increase compared to the same period last year. Mandarins made up 62% of the total volume, followed by Tahiti limes.

Bangladesh's vegetable exports through sea shipments have increased by 313% in just one year.
2025-07-08 00:00
Bangladesh's vegetable exports have experienced a remarkable recovery, with an increase of over 313% in the fiscal year 2024-25. The Plant Quarantine Centre at Chittagong Seaport reported that sea shipments amounted to 58,766 metric tons, a significant rise from the previous year's 14,202 tons.
